  • Did you Know? (July 2026)
    In 1898, eleven proprietary drug companies, 10 in St. Louis, made a deal with the IRS to print their own proprietary tax stamps for use until the delayed federal tax stamps arrived. These came to be known as the St. Louis Provisionals. Want one? Get your checkbook out. Most of them have a five-figure value!
  • Famous Postal Employees: Abraham Lincoln (June 2026)
    Lincoln’s postal career is one of the most charming and humanizing chapters of his early life — and it played a real role in shaping his reputation for honesty and public service. Lincoln, like Washington and Franklin, has appeared on over 1,000 stamps worldwide.
